Creationism is the belief, or strongly held opinion, that the universe, the Earth and all forms of life including man were created in their present form by a creator god, in practice usually the abrahamic God.
Evolution is change in the genetic nature of a population of organisms from one generation to the next, as a result of a combination of three main processes: variation, reproduction, and natural selection. In this context it refers to the evolution of entirely new species over time.

To compare creationism to evolution is to compare opinion that is unsupported by evidence, to evidence-based scientific theory.

What are the two kinds of Creationism?

The two main kinds of Creationism are young Earth Creationism, which believes in a literal interpretation of the Bible and asserts that the Earth is only a few thousand years old, and old Earth Creationism, which accepts scientific evidence for the age of the Earth but still believes in a divine creator.
